Cohiba Creator Avelino Lara Passes Away
By Patrick S. (Stogie Guys)
Legendary cigar maker Avelino Lara died yesterday due to complications from thyroid cancer. Once Fidel Castro’s personal roller, Lara was famous for his creations at the El Laguito Factory outside of Havana, where he crafted some of of the most famous Cuban cigars, including the Cohiba brand.
Born in Havana on March 20, 1921, Lara worked in the cigar business all his life. He trained and mastered the art of a torcedor at a young age. After decades of working in the Cuban cigar industry, including having a hand in some of the best-known blends ever created, Lara retired in 1996, in part because he was unhappy with government interference in cigar making.
